What Are Internal Audit Firms?

Internal audit firms are professional service providers that evaluate a company’s internal systems, processes, and controls. Unlike external auditors who focus on financial statements, internal auditors focus on improving internal operations and risk management.

internal audit firms typically help businesses by:

  • Evaluating internal controls

  • Identifying operational risks

  • Improving compliance systems

  • Detecting inefficiencies

  • Preventing fraud and errors

  • Enhancing governance structures

Their goal is to ensure that a company operates effectively, efficiently, and in compliance with regulations.

Internal Audit vs External Audit

Feature

Internal Audit

External Audit

Purpose

Improve operations

Validate financial statements

Conducted by

Internal audit firms

Independent external auditors

Focus

Processes & risks

Financial accuracy

Frequency

Continuous or periodic

Usually annual

Both functions are important, but internal audit firms focus more on improving internal business performance.

Internal Audit Process

Internal audit firms follow a structured process to evaluate business operations effectively.

1. Planning

Understanding business objectives and identifying audit areas.

2. Risk Identification

Assessing potential risks in operations and finance.

3. Data Collection

Gathering relevant financial and operational information.

4. Analysis

Reviewing processes, controls, and compliance systems.

5. Reporting

Presenting findings and recommendations to management.

6. Follow-Up

Ensuring corrective actions are implemented.
